ETL(Extract, Transform, Load)与工作流管理是云计算领域中常见的数据处理和任务调度技术。它们虽然有一些相似之处,但在功能和应用场景上有所不同。
ETL是一种数据处理过程,用于从不同的数据源中提取数据,经过转换和清洗后加载到目标数据仓库或数据库中。ETL的主要目标是将数据从源系统中抽取出来,进行必要的转换和清洗,最后加载到目标系统中,以支持数据分析和决策。ETL通常用于数据仓库、商业智能和数据分析等场景。
工作流管理是一种任务调度和流程管理技术,用于定义、执行和监控复杂的业务流程和任务流。它可以将多个任务按照一定的逻辑顺序组织起来,并根据预定的规则和条件自动触发和执行这些任务。工作流管理通常用于业务流程自动化、任务调度和协同工作等场景。
虽然ETL和工作流管理在某些方面有相似之处,例如它们都涉及到任务的执行和数据的处理,但它们的功能和应用场景是不同的。ETL主要用于数据处理和数据集成,而工作流管理主要用于任务调度和流程管理。
在实际应用中,ETL和工作流管理可以使用相同的方式进行开发和管理,例如使用编程语言(如Python、Java)或专门的工具(如Apache Airflow、Talend等)。然而,由于它们的功能和应用场景不同,通常会选择不同的工具和技术来实现它们。
对于ETL,腾讯云提供了一系列相关产品和服务,例如腾讯云数据传输服务(Data Transfer Service)和腾讯云数据集成服务(Data Integration Service),用于实现数据的抽取、转换和加载。您可以通过以下链接了解更多信息:
对于工作流管理,腾讯云提供了腾讯云工作流(Tencent Workflow),用于实现任务调度和流程管理。您可以通过以下链接了解更多信息:
领取专属 10元无门槛券
手把手带您无忧上云